ARSIEM is looking for a Host-based Systems Analyst . This position is remote with business travel as needed. Personnel will be required to live in the Continental US and are required to work core hours (Eastern Standard Time) to support one of our Government clients in Arlington, VA.

Responsibilities

  • Perform event correlation using information gathered from a variety of sources within the enterprise to gain situational awareness and determine the effectiveness of an observed attack

  • Assesses network topology and device configurations identifying critical security concerns and providing security best practice recommendations

  • Collects network intrusion artifacts (e.g., PCAP, domains, URIs, certificates, etc.) and uses discovered data to enable mitigation of potential incidents

  • Collects network device integrity data and analyzes for signs of tampering or compromise

  • Analyzes identified malicious network and system log activity to determine weaknesses exploited, exploitation methods, effects on system and information

  • Tracking and documenting on-site incident response activities and providing updates to leadership through executive summaries and in-depth technical reports

  • Planning, coordinating and directing the inventory, examination and comprehensive technical analysis of computer-related evidence

  • Serving as technical forensics liaison to stakeholders and explaining investigation details

Minimum Qualifications

  • 8+ years of experience and BS Computer Science, Cybersecurity, Computer Engineering or related degree; or HS Diploma and 10+ years of host or digital forensics or network forensic experience

  • 8+ years of directly relevant experience in cyber forensic and network investigations using leading-edge technologies and industry-standard forensic tools

  • Experience with reconstructing a malicious attack or activity

  • Ability to characterize and analyze network traffic, identify anomalous activity / potential threats, and analyze anomalies in network traffic using metadata

  • Ability to create forensically sound duplicates of evidence (forensic images)

  • Able to write cyber investigative reports documenting forensics findings

  • Knowledge and experience in identifying different classes and characterization of attacks and attack stages

  • Knowledge and experience of CND policies, procedures and regulations

  • Knowledge and experience in proactive analysis of systems and networks, including creating trust levels of critical resources

  • Knowledge and experience of system and application security threats and vulnerabilities

  • Knowledge and experience of network topologies, Wi-Fi Networking, and TCP/IP protocols

  • Knowledge and experience with Splunk (or other SIEMs)

  • Knowledge and experience of Vulnerability scanning, assessment and monitoring tools such as Security Center, Nessus, and Endgame

  • Knowledge and experience of MITRE Adversary Tactics, Techniques and Common Knowledge (ATT&CK)

  • Must be able to work collaboratively across physical locations.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Experience and proficiency with the following tools and techniques:

  • EnCase, FTK, SIFT, X-Ways, Volatility, WireShark, Sleuth Kit/Autopsy, and Snort

  • EDR Tools: Crowdstrike, Carbon Black, Etc

  • Carving and extracting information from PCAP data

  • Non-traditional network traffic: Command and Control

  • Preserving evidence integrity according to national standards

  • Designing cyber security systems and environments in a Linux environment

  • Virtualized environments

  • Conducting all-source research

  • Desired Certifications: GCFA, GCFE, EnCE, CCE, CFCE, CEH, CCNA, CCSP, CCIE, OSCP, GNFA

Clearance Requirement: This position requires an Active TS/SCI clearance and the ability to obtain Department of Homeland Security (DHS) Entry on Duty (EOD) Suitability.
